Clare TDs (4)
/Clare pop: 104,000 /electorate 70,500
Tony Killeen FF
Age 57/in Dáil since 1992 /Current Junior Minister for Environment (?)
Timmy Dooley FF
Age 40/elected first time in 2007
Joe Carey FGAge 35/elected first time 2007 / son of a former TD
Pat Breen FGAge 59/elected before but not the last time
